Output 3d89e27df859856eb70d60427be87b85e517998305e35c3e5876f85baf4d8782:6

value
19756970
script pubkey
OP_0 OP_PUSHBYTES_20 cc5f69e1384c0ae5d0ef4f2b8b10ea86eb086e82
address
ltc1qe30kncfcfs9wt580fu4cky82sm4ssm5zq9p3d4
transaction
3d89e27df859856eb70d60427be87b85e517998305e35c3e5876f85baf4d8782
spent
true